Output d32ce10d87eca8b4e6d69b5940fadd3a6ec4076cbbc37f22b8fa890e4a0ee6b6:0

value
532950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051c0c2868c2169e4f7d61c5e6ec6e042a8611b0 OP_EQUAL
address
32A2uH1MyrDhTsRvwGZWTJZxhCUNxJfMqj
transaction
d32ce10d87eca8b4e6d69b5940fadd3a6ec4076cbbc37f22b8fa890e4a0ee6b6
confirmations
23331
spent
true